This letter acknowledges receipt of Niagara Hohawk Power Corporation's (NHPC's) responses dated April 18,

1994, and Hay 31, 1994, for Nine Nile Point Nuclear Station Unit No.

1 to NRC Bulletin 93-02, Supplement 1 (Bulletin).

The Bulletin was issued February 18, 1994, for action to all Boiling Water Reactor (BWR) licensees and for information to all Pressurized Water Reactor (PWR) licensees.

The purpose of the Bulletin was to inform BWR and PWR licensees about the vulnerability of ECCS suction str ainers in BWRs and containment sumps in PWRs to clogging during the recirculation phase of a loss-of-coolant accident (LOCA), to request that BWR licensees take the appropriate actions to ensure reliability of the ECCS in view of the information discussed in this bulletin supplement, and to require that BWR licensees report to the NRC on the requested actions taken.

The April 18,

1994, response addressed the actions NHPC was taking to assure the operability of ECCS recirculation.

The May 31,

1994, response confirmed completion of the planned actions.

Please retain any records of NHPC's actions in response to this Bulletin, as subsequent inspection activities may be conducted in regard to this issue.

Please contact me at (301) 504-1409 if you have any questions regarding this issue.

All NRC staff activities related to TAC No. H89299 are considered complete.
